Dehydrated Cassava

Dehydrated cassava, also known as manioc or yuca, is a starchy root vegetable that is rich in carbohydrates and provides a good source of energy. It is commonly used in various culinary applications, particularly in tropical regions.

Rich in carbohydrates, dehydrated cassava serves as an excellent energy source, making it ideal for athletes and active individuals.
High fiber content aids in digestion and promotes gut health, potentially reducing the risk of gastrointestinal disorders.

Amaranth Flour

Amaranth flour is a gluten-free flour made from the seeds of the amaranth plant, known for its high protein and nutrient content. It is rich in fiber, vitamins, and minerals, making it a nutritious alternative to traditional flours.

Amaranth flour is an excellent source of complete protein, containing all nine essential amino acids, which is particularly beneficial for vegetarians and vegans.
It is high in fiber, which aids in digestion and helps maintain a healthy gut microbiome.

2. Micronutrient Profile (Vitamins and Minerals)

Micronutrient analysis highlights the essential vitamins and minerals of each food, expressed as a percentage of the recommended Daily Value (%DV).

Dehydrated Cassava's profile is highly notable for: vitamin-c (20mg, 22% VDR) and potassium (271mg, 6% VDR).

Conversely, Amaranth Flour stands out especially in: magnesium (270mg, 68% VDR) and phosphorus (457mg, 65% VDR) and iron (7.6mg, 42% VDR).
